LAKE PLACID, NY – Manhattan Men's Golf competed in the Columbia Autumn Invitational on Saturday and Sunday from Lake Placid Golf Club.
HOW IT HAPPENED
- One of the lowest rounds as a program for the Jaspers came to fruition in Lake Placid on Saturday afternoon, as Cabell Faulkner paced the Green and White with a two under par performance, good for eighth overall on the day. Faulkner netted two under in the front nine, after totaling seven pars. He completed the first round three under on the afternoon.
- Throughout the round, the Jaspers shot five under, with Louis Vandeputte shooting two under par. Aidan Talent posted a 70, one under par, while Walter Carley registered one over par and a score of 72.
- The first-round total broke the previous record by seven shots for total score, and three shots relative to par from last season's Testudo Cup.
- Manhattan continued right where it left off in the second round as Faulkner continued to pace the Jaspers, highlighted with a 12th hole eagle.
- Five out of the six Jaspers posted birdies on the third hole, which served as a par five in one of the toughest holes on the course.
- On the second day, the Jaspers were once again led by Faulkner who shot even with a couple of birdies, and two under par, while Talent posted four over, good for second on the team.
QUOTES FROM THE JASPERS
Head Coach
Keith Prokop: "We are showing signs of growth. Obviously a historic first day, so we have great potential just need to keep the growth mindset and expand on our golf intellect and we will be in a great spot. For us it's not about how we play in the fall, more about what the tail end of the spring looks like."
